Build provenance — RateNest tax-rate lookup cache. Every cache artifact is built by the Fernway pipeline from the rates-snapshot repo; nothing is hand-assembled. Contractors: never edit the cache blob directly. To verify an artifact, check its manifest hash against the pipeline record, then confirm the jurisdiction snapshot date matches the release notes. Each verified artifact carries a provenance token, recorded immediately below.

session token of tajef-bageg = htk21_5d90d574934f3ccae6437

The Ferngate consent banner is gated per region by CONSENT_ROLLOUT_REGIONS, a comma-separated list. Support can verify a customer's region is enabled before escalating rendering issues. CONSENT_LOG_LEVEL controls how much banner telemetry reaches the audit stream; leave it at "info" unless engineering asks otherwise. Preference writes go to the consent vault, which rejects unauthenticated calls, so every environment must also carry the vault credential — it appears on the line immediately below this paragraph.

env line for fafof-fahag: LEDGER_TOKEN5=f8790

Subject: Formula sandbox cut-over — done

Hey Marisol,

Quick recap for your review: we finished moving user-supplied formulas in Quillbay off the old in-process evaluator and onto the Hollowvine sandbox runtime last night. Each formula now runs in an isolated worker with CPU and memory caps, no filesystem or network access, and a 200ms hard timeout. Rollback path stays live for two weeks. The sandbox settings we shipped with are listed below for your audit.

settings of tagef-bawif:
DRUIX_HOST=druix.zemvarlabs.internal
DRUIX_PORT=8000

### Step 4: Carve out the user module

Alright, time to lift the user module out of the Bramblecore monolith. Reviewers: check that the new Userhaven service owns all session logic before approving. Wire the monolith to proxy auth calls during cutover. Userhaven expects the following configuration values at startup.

config for kafof-bawef:
holath:
  log_level: debug
  metrics_host: metrics.holath.qorvelsys.internal
  pin: 2191
  pool_size: 32